# Spooler constants for the Printlane microservice.
# Support team: these govern retry and queue-drain behavior when
# the Kestrelmark office printers stall mid-job. Do not raise the
# retry cap without checking queue depth first; stuck jobs multiply
# fast during month-end batch runs. Values were tuned after the
# Harlowe Branch incident and are considered stable.
# The current tuning constants are listed below.

limits module of fajog-tawig:
RATE_LIMITS = {
    "druwyn": 2,
    "quenael": 10,
    "wenix": 2,
    "druael": 2,
}

## Further reading

Twiglet, our stale-branch cleanup bot, nags after 30 days of inactivity and deletes after 60 unless a branch is pinned. Most questions at the sync boil down to "how do I pin" — short answer: add the keep label. Exemption rules, the nag schedule, and the restore procedure for accidentally deleted branches are documented on the internal page.

dashboard of yaguf-hahig = https://grafana.urlaqworks.test/secrets

[ ] Run the Quillgate docs linter against the full handbook before tagging the release. It checks heading depth, stale anchors, and banned terminology. Warnings are fine; errors block the tag. If the linter itself was updated this cycle, rerun on a clean checkout to rule out cache issues. Record the passing build below.

trace token, fafog-kageg: htk4_98e6

Ticket SEC-883: Misconfigured env on the Ovenbird thumbnail workers. Prod workers were deployed with the staging env file, so the thumbnail generation queue authenticated against the staging broker and prod jobs piled up for six hours. No data crossed environments; staging rejected the writes. Remediation: redeploy workers with the prod env. For review, the corrected file must include the following line.

vault entry, yahif-yajep: COURIER_KEY29=b802bdf8034096b65a51c6ba5abe2